What Are WooCommerce Shipping Methods?


Shipping methods in WooCommerce are the different ways you can charge and deliver products to your customers. These methods determine the shipping cost and how the product will reach the buyer.


WooCommerce comes with three default shipping methods, and you can enhance these options with plugins for more complex needs.







Default WooCommerce Shipping Methods


Here are the three core shipping methods included with WooCommerce:





  1. Flat Rate Shipping





    • Set a fixed shipping cost per item, per order, or per shipping class.




    • Ideal for stores with consistent product sizes and weights.






  2. Free Shipping





    • Offer free delivery on certain products, coupon usage, or orders over a specific amount.




    • Encourages higher cart value and boosts conversions.






  3. Local Pickup





    • Customers collect their orders in person from a physical location.




    • Great for local businesses and reducing delivery time and cost.










How to Set Up Shipping Methods in WooCommerce


Follow these steps to configure shipping methods:





  1. Go to WooCommerce > Settings > Shipping.




  2. Create Shipping Zones (e.g., by country, state, or region).




  3. Click into each zone and add your preferred Shipping Methods.




  4. Customize pricing, tax settings, and restrictions as needed.




You can also use Shipping Classes to apply specific rules or rates to certain product categories.







Advanced WooCommerce Shipping Methods (with Plugins)


To take your shipping to the next level, consider these advanced plugins:





  • Table Rate Shipping





    • Create rules based on weight, number of items, destination, and more.






  • WooCommerce Shipping & Tax





    • Automatically calculates real-time shipping rates from major carriers like USPS and DHL.






  • Flexible Shipping by WP Desk





    • Set advanced conditions for shipping costs using cart totals or dimensions.






  • Shippo or ShipStation Integration





    • Automate your shipping workflow, print labels, and track packages efficiently.
